I love the action, cinematography, acting, pacing in this movie but I don't like the second half. I watched the first half of this movie (up to the end of Django's winter/bounty hunting) and I was like "this movie kicks butt, one of the best westerns I've seen" and then I watched the second half and I was like "eh". I think it loses focus and it feels like Tarantino didn't really know where to go with the story once he got to candyland so he just added a bunch of violence and explosions. Still fun to watch but it just feels hollow imo.
